The CryptGenKey function generates a random cryptographic session key or a public/private key pair. A handle to the key or key pair is returned in phKey. This handle can then be used as needed with any CryptoAPI function that requires a key handle. The calling application must specify the ... WebBest Crypto APIs: list of the best APIs for cryptocurrency traders and devs Sign up for: Coinbase Binance.US Crypto.com Robinhood Simpleswap Buy/sell/send Manage … WebSymmetric ciphers, however, typically support multiple key sizes (e.g. AES-128 vs. AES-192 vs. AES-256). These key sizes are determined with the length of the provided key. Thus, the kernel crypto API does not provide a separate way to select the particular symmetric cipher key size.
